Home to Lake Winnipeg, one of the world’s largest inland bodies of freshwater and a place perfect for viewing the Northern Lights, Manitoba draws in travellers from all around the world. It’s a place many might not have heard of, but after listening to this episode, you’ll be itching to visit!

The Travel Podcast team welcomes Don to learn about the prime polar bear season, the friendly population and the passion for culture.

About Don:

Don has a Bachelor of Arts degree from the University of Manitoba and is the owner, manager of Heartland International Travel and Tours. He has been in the travel/tourism industry since 1974. He developed the incoming/receptive division of McDonald Worldwide Travel in 1990 and this incoming/receptive concept was the cornerstone of Heartland International Travel and Tours in 2001. He has created many Winnipeg and Manitoba tours that showcase our city and province to tourists. He is very familiar with all attractions and hotel properties in Winnipeg and is capable of guiding groups on any general or customized tours of the city and province. In 2018 he was the recipient of the Tourism of Winnipeg Awards of Distinction – Lifetime Achievement Award. He is a member of Meeting Professionals International, Team Winnipeg, Winnipeg Tour Connection, Heritage Winnipeg, Canadian History Society, and SKAL
